The gearbox in your car will physically fit ANY other TU engine from a Saxo/106/AX. The 200mm clutch for the 16v will work just fine.
You do not need to change the drive axles/shafts.
You do not need to change the fuse box.
There will be no change needed for your interior wiring loom.
you do not need a radiator with 2 fans, unless you have air conditioning.
Racing flywheel and twin clutch is a waste of time unless you're going racing competitively.
Your car is from 2003, it is a 3 plug model. 3 plug means the ECU is 3 plug type.
There is no risk of "crossover" in 2003 either. Crossover is a mix of 3 plug and single plug loom usually around 1999/2000.
Single plug is 1 big ECU plug from 1996-1999.
You need a Saxo 1.6 16v engine, engine loom and ECU, with immobiliser disabled OR with the black immobiliser box plus key to match to swap with your 1.4 immobiliser on your interior loom.
